Can you use pictures from Pinterest without permission?

Can you use pictures from Pinterest without permission?

Pinterest terms clearly say that you’re responsible for the user content you post. However, if the image you’re repinning appears on Pinterest without permission from the author, you could be committing copyright infringement because you’re “solely responsible” for anything you post.

What happens if you print a copyrighted image?

What will happen to me if I print a copyrighted image? If you knowingly violate copyright by printing copyrighted photos for personal use, you are liable to pay damages to the copyright owner. If the image is registered with the copyright office you may be required to pay statutory damages and all attorney fees.

How do you know if an image is copyrighted?

One good way to see if a photo is copyrighted is by reverse searching for the image. Right click on the image and select “copy image address”. Then paste this into Google Images or a site dedicated to reverse image search, like TinEye. This will show you where the image is used, and where it has come from.

How do you get banned from Pinterest?

Accounts may be suspended due to single or repeat violations of our Community Guidelines concerning:

  1. Pinner Safety (for example: hateful speech, pornography, graphic imagery and misinformation)
  2. Account security (including impersonation and third-party logins)
  3. Spam.
  4. Intellectual property.
